I inherited an Access97 MDE application which tracks projects. The programmers who created this application had deleted the MDB version before they left. Under Windows 95 and 98 the application runs fine (using Access97). The problem is the application does not work on a machine with Windows 2000 and Access 97 installed. I never receive error messages but the Command buttons that should produce recordsets do nothing.

Without having the original MDB file is it possible to get this application to ever work? Is there any workaround to this problem? I understand that the problem could be associated with the DAO references but I am not sure why I am still having this problem if I am running Access 97 under Windows 2000.
